This document presents the RF exposure evaluation for the 2A49Z-FLASHBADGER portable device, conducted by Shenzhen CTB Testing Co., Ltd. The evaluation ensures compliance with FCC regulations, specifically §15.247(e)(i) and §1.1307(b)(1), which mandate that devices operate in a manner that does not expose the public to excessive radio frequency energy levels.
The assessment follows the guidelines outlined in KDB447498 D01 General RF Exposure Guidance V06. The 1-g and 10-g SAR test exclusion thresholds are calculated for frequencies between 100 MHz and 6 GHz, with test separation distances of ≤ 50 mm. The calculation considers the maximum power of the channel, including tune-up tolerance, and the minimum test separation distance. The formula used is [(max. power of channel, including tune-up tolerance, mW)/(min. test separation distance, mm)]·[√f(GHZ)] ≤ 3.0 for 1-g SAR and ≤ 7.5 for 10-g extremity SAR.
The results indicate that the device meets the SAR test exclusion criteria. The maximum calculated result is 0.00105, which is below the FCC limit of 3.0 for 1g SAR. Therefore, the device is deemed compliant with RF exposure regulations.
